+/* return 0 or 1 depending if users u and u2 share one or more common channels
+ * (used by QUIT, NICK etc which arent channel specific notices)
+ *
+ * The old algorithm in 1.0 for this was relatively inefficient, iterating over
+ * the first users channels then the second users channels within the outer loop,
+ * therefore it was a maximum of x*y iterations (upon returning 0 and checking
+ * all possible iterations). However this new function instead checks against the
+ * channel's userlist in the inner loop which is a std::map<User*,User*>
+ * and saves us time as we already know what pointer value we are after.
+ * Don't quote me on the maths as i am not a mathematician or computer scientist,
+ * but i believe this algorithm is now x+(log y) maximum iterations instead.
+ */
+bool User::SharesChannelWith(User *other)
+{
+ if ((!other) || (this->registered != REG_ALL) || (other->registered != REG_ALL))
+ return false;
+
+ /* Outer loop */
+ for (UCListIter i = this->chans.begin(); i != this->chans.end(); i++)
+ {
+ /* Eliminate the inner loop (which used to be ~equal in size to the outer loop)
+ * by replacing it with a map::find which *should* be more efficient
+ */
+ if (i->first->HasUser(other))
+ return true;
+ }
+ return false;
+}
